NYSARC, Inc. is a leading not-for-profit organization founded in 1949 to improve the quality of life for individuals with intellectual and other developmental disabilities. As one of the largest agencies of its kind in the United States, it provides a wide range of services, including adult day programs, vocational training, and employment support, empowering individuals to lead more independent, productive, and fulfilling lives.
